Using drones for delivery comes with its share of upsides and downsides. Here's a breakdown of the pros and cons to help you weigh the potential benefits and challenges:
Pros:
Faster Delivery:
- Drones have the capability to significantly reduce delivery times by avoiding traffic congestion and taking direct routes to destinations. This swiftness is particularly advantageous for time-sensitive deliveries or perishable goods, where quick transportation is crucial to maintain product quality and meet urgent demands.
Cost-effectiveness:
- Implementing drone delivery systems can potentially reduce operational expenses in the long term. They require fewer labor resources and less infrastructure compared to traditional delivery vehicles, thereby cutting down on operational costs.
Accessibility:
- Drones can access remote or challenging terrains that ground vehicles may struggle to reach, such as mountainous areas or islands. This ability enhances the opportunities for delivering essential goods and services to underserved or geographically isolated communities.
Environmentally Friendly:
- Drones, especially those powered by electricity, contribute to a lower carbon footprint compared to traditional delivery vehicles. By reducing reliance on fossil fuels, drone delivery can aid in curbing air pollution and contributing to efforts to combat climate change.
Improved Safety:
- Drones can operate on designated flight paths, avoiding the risks associated with ground traffic, and are less prone to accidents compared to traditional vehicles. This enhanced safety factor is beneficial, particularly in densely populated areas or areas with challenging road conditions.
Cons:
Limited Payload Capacity:
- Current drone technology imposes restrictions on the size and weight of packages that can be carried, limiting the types of goods suitable for delivery. Larger or heavier items may not be feasible for transport via drones, restricting their versatility.
Weather Dependence:
- Adverse weather conditions like strong winds, heavy rain, or snow can significantly impede drone operations, leading to delays and disruptions in delivery schedules. This dependence on favorable weather poses a challenge for reliable and consistent service.
Regulations and Safety Concerns:
- Ensuring safe and compliant drone operations involves addressing various concerns, including airspace regulations, noise pollution, privacy issues, and potential security risks. Striking a balance between innovation and regulatory measures is crucial for the responsible integration of drones into the airspace.
Technology Limitations:
- Battery life and operational range remain technological limitations for drones. Improvements in battery technology are essential to extend flight durations and expand the distance drones can cover in a single trip.
Public Acceptance:
- Concerns about privacy invasion, noise disturbance, and safety risks may lead to public resistance towards widespread drone delivery. Building trust through transparent communication, addressing concerns, and demonstrating the benefits is essential to gain public support.
In conclusion, while drone delivery holds significant promise in transforming logistics and enhancing delivery services, addressing the outlined limitations and concerns is crucial for its responsible and sustainable implementation. As technology continues to advance and regulations evolve to accommodate these innovations, drone delivery is poised to play an increasingly substantial role in the future of logistics and transportation.
